XML 133 R117.htm IDEA: XBRL DOCUMENT v3.24.0.1
SHARE-BASED COMPENSATION - Components of Awards (Details) - USD ($)
$ in Thousands
12 Months Ended
Dec. 31, 2023
Dec. 31, 2022
Dec. 31, 2021
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Pre-tax compensation expense $ 5,158 $ 4,652 $ 4,762
Income tax benefit (1,250) (1,117) (947)
Total share-based compensation expense, net of income taxes 3,908 3,535 3,815
Stock and ESPP Options      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Pre-tax compensation expense 103 95 155
Income tax benefit (62) (74) (92)
Total share-based compensation expense, net of income taxes 41 21 63
Restricted Stock Awards      
Share-based Compensation Arrangement by Share-based Payment Award [Line Items]      
Pre-tax compensation expense 5,055 4,557 4,607
Income tax benefit (1,188) (1,043) (855)
Total share-based compensation expense, net of income taxes $ 3,867 $ 3,514 $ 3,752